Sex & Nudity

  • A sequence of about ten to fifteen minutes takes place in a bordello, where prostitutes are shown in very revealing attire that borders on nudity. For example, one woman is shown with pasties covering her otherwise bare breasts. No real sexuality is shown, but innuendos and implications are present.
  • A man and woman are implied to have sex. The woman is shown wearing only a towel, but there is no nudity and the film cuts away after the couple starts kissing.

Violence & Gore

  • As the films title suggests, assassination and murder play a heavy role in the story. However, deaths are largely implied or bloodless. There are several shootings, but the impact of the bullets is not shown. Explosions also kill, but mostly offscreen.
  • One man sets another on fire, killing him.
